access是用什么语言

Access是用什么语言

access是用什么语言

概述

Microsoft Access是一款广泛使用的关系数据库管理系统(RDBMS),它使用Visual Basic for Applications(VBA)作为其编程语言。VBA是一种高级编程语言,用于自动化Access应用程序,创建自定义表单和报告,以及连接外部数据源。王利头!

VBA简介

VBA是Microsoft开发的一种编程语言,专用于Office应用程序,包括Access。它是一种面向对象的语言,这意味着它允许开发人员创建具有特定属性和方法的对象。VBA基于Visual Basic 6.0,并提供了广泛的功能,包括:

  • 变量和数据类型
  • 控制结构(if/else、循环)
  • 子例程(函数、过程)
  • 事件处理
  • 对象模型

VBA在Access中的应用

在Access中,VBA用于创建和修改数据库对象,例如:

  • 表单:VBA代码可以创建和自定义用户表单,用于数据输入和显示。
  • 报告:VBA代码可以生成和格式化报告,从数据库中提取数据。
  • 查询:VBA代码可以动态创建和修改查询,以满足特定的数据检索需求。
  • 宏:VBA代码可以创建宏,以自动化重复性任务,例如数据导入或导出。
  • 模块:VBA代码可以组织成模块,以提高代码的可重用性和可维护性。

VBA示例

以下是一个简单的VBA示例,它显示了一条消息框:

vba
Sub ShowMessage()
MsgBox "你好,世界!"
End Sub

要运行此代码,请在Access中打开模块并将其粘贴进去。然后,单击运行按钮或按F5。将显示一条消息框,显示消息“你好,世界!”。HTML在线运行?批量打开网址?SEO,

VBA与其他编程语言

与其他编程语言相比,VBA具有以下优点:wanglitou.

  • 易学:VBA基于易于理解的语法,使其成为初学者和有经验的开发人员的绝佳选择。
  • 集成性强:VBA与Access无缝集成,允许开发人员直接从Access中创建和修改数据库对象。
  • 自动化:VBA可以自动化繁琐的任务,例如数据处理和报告生成,从而节省时间并提高效率。
  • 可扩展性:VBA代码可以与其他编程语言(如C#和Python)接口,以实现更高级的功能。
相关阅读:  营销策略有哪些4种

结论

Microsoft Access使用Visual Basic for Applications(VBA)作为其编程语言。VBA是一种高级编程语言,允许开发人员自动化Access应用程序,创建自定义表单和报告,以及连接外部数据源。VBA的易用性、集成性、自动化和可扩展性使其成为Access开发人员的宝贵工具。

常见问题解答

问:VBA与Visual Basic 6.0有什么区别?
答:VBA基于Visual Basic 6.0,但它包含了针对Office应用程序的特定功能和扩展。JS转Excel.

问:我可以使用VBA创建独立的应用程序吗?
答:否,VBA仅用于自动化Office应用程序,如Access。

问:VBA是面向对象的语言吗?
答:是的,VBA是一种面向对象的语言,允许开发人员创建具有特定属性和方法的对象。

问:VBA代码如何与Access对象进行交互?
答:VBA代码可以通过对象模型与Access对象进行交互,允许开发人员控制对象的行为和属性。wangli.

问:哪里可以找到有关VBA编程的更多信息?
答:微软文档、社区论坛和在线教程提供了有关VBA编程的丰富信息和资源。

在线字数统计,

原创文章,作者:诸葛武凡,如若转载,请注明出处:https://www.wanglitou.cn/article_133592.html

(0)
打赏 微信扫一扫 微信扫一扫
上一篇 2024-09-19 02:39
下一篇 2024-09-19 03:00

相关推荐

公众号